HG808 Super High Temperature Dew Point Transmitter
The HG808 is an industrial-grade temperature, humidity, and dew point transmitter designed for harsh environments with high temperatures even over 190℃. In addition to measuring and transmitting temperature and humidity, the HG808 calculates and transmits the dew point, which is the temperature at which air becomes saturated with water vapor and condensation begins to form.

Here’s a specification details for the HG808-A series Dew Point Transmitter :
Category | Specification |
---|---|
Temperature Range | -50 ~ +180°C |
Humidity Range | 0 ~ 100% RH (Recommend < 95% RH) |
Temperature Accuracy | ±0.1°C (@ 20°C) |
Dew Point Accuracy | ±3% RH (± 5.4 °F) Td |
Power Supply | DC 10V ~ 28V |
Power Consumption | < 0.5W |
Analog Outputs | Humidity + Temperature: 4~20mA / 0-5V / 0-10V (one out of three) |
RS485 Digital Output | Temperature, humidity, dew point, PPM (read simultaneously) |
Resolution Ratio | 0.01°C / 0.1°C (optional) 0.01% RH / 0.1% RH (optional) |
Baud Rate | 1200, 2400, 4800, 9600, 19200, 115200 (default: 9600 bps) |
Acquisition Frequency | Fastest response: 1 second; other settings per PLC |
Byte Format | 8 data bits, 1 stop bit, no check |
Pressurization | 16 bar |
Working Temperature | -20°C ~ +60°C, 0% RH ~ 95% RH (Non-condensation) |
Probe Type | Split type: Probe 0 –Split type :0A# / 0B# Probe 8 –Split type :8A# / 8B# |

Line Color | Definition | Specification |
---|---|---|
Power Cord | ||
Red | Power supply positive | 10 ~ 30V DC |
Black | Power supply negative | GND |
Analog Output Lines | ||
Brown | Temperature signal positive | 4-20mA output |
Blue | Temperature signal negative | Connects to Black (GND) |
Grey | Humidity signal positive | 4-20mA output |
White | Humidity signal negative | Connects to Black (GND) |
RS485 Wiring | ||
Yellow | RS485A | Twisted pair cable |
Green | RS485B | Twisted pair cable |
